Cutting onions slowly and using the sharpest knives available can reduce eye irritation, physicists have found in a new study. A familiar and painful experience for home cooks, crying while chopping ...
No longer will dinner prep be a tear-inducing experience if you follow these two tips from researchers from Cornell University.
Onions can be cut by slicing, dicing, mincing, or by cutting into rings and wedges. Be sure to use a sharp chef's knife to help prevent eye irritation.
